Overview
Basingstoke and Deane is a local government district with borough status in Hampshire. The main town is Basingstoke, where the borough council is based, and the district also includes Tadley, Whitchurch, and numerous villages. The modern district was created in 1974 and renamed Basingstoke and Deane in 1978, with the term “Deane” chosen to represent the rural parts of the borough. Parts of the borough lie within the North Wessex Downs, an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ty, giving the area a strong rural dimension alongside its urban center. This landscape helps keep the borough connected to open countryside even as Basingstoke continues to grow.
Landscape and Local Places
The borough covers a wide area, with Basingstoke acting as the main hub and a network of villages and small towns surrounding it. The inclusion of North Wessex Downs landscape gives the borough rolling countryside and protected scenery, which balances the town’s growth. This mix means visitors can experience both a busy modern town and a quieter rural environment within a short distance. The smaller towns and villages provide a slower tempo that contrasts with the pace of the main urban center. This contrast is part of the borough’s appeal for short, calm breaks.
History and Civic Identity
Basingstoke has a long civic history, with borough status dating back centuries. The modern borough structure dates to the 1974 reorganization, which brought together several former districts. The 1978 name change to Basingstoke and Deane reinforced the borough’s dual character: a major town paired with extensive rural communities. This dual identity remains central to how the borough presents itself, with civic services and community life spread across both urban and rural settings.
